In Oko Amakom, Nigeria, a woman is hunched over a pile of carrots on the ground, preparing them for sale. She is using a knife to trim the carrots, her movements focused and efficient. Her attire consists of a dark grey top and a patterned skirt with shades of yellow and green. Beside her, a white sack lies open, spilling out more carrots, suggesting a bountiful harvest. The ground is dusty and uneven, characteristic of an outdoor market. The scene is bustling with activity, though the focus remains on the woman and her task. In the background, other individuals can be seen engaged in various activities, some interacting with stalls and others simply present in the marketplace. The overall environment appears to be a vibrant, outdoor market, filled with the energy of commerce and daily life. The presence of makeshift structures and hanging fabrics suggests a temporary or open-air market setup. The lighting indicates it is daytime, with sunlight casting shadows on the ground.
